Abstract
Complement is a key component of immune defence against infection; it potently drives inflammation at sites of pathology and is essential for killing of pathogens. Genetic linkage of common complement polymorphisms to disease has advanced the concept that subtle changes in complement activity significantly affect disease risk. Functional analyses of disease-linked polymorphic variants demonstrate that, although individual polymorphisms cause only small changes in activity, when combined, the aggregate effects are large. The inherited set of common variants, the complotype, thus has a major impact on susceptibility to inflammatory and infectious diseases. Assessing the complotype of an individual will aid prediction of disease risk and inform intervention to reduce or eliminate risk.Entities:

Figure 1Functional effects of complement protein polymorphisms. C3b generated by tickover routes binds surfaces through its thioester. C3b captures factor B (fB) to form the alternative pathway (AP) pro-convertase (C3bB). Factor D (fD) cleaves fB in the pro-convertase to yield C3 convertase (C3bBb); this cleaves more C3 to C3b that binds membranes, captures fB and builds more convertase (the AP amplification loop). The plasma AP regulator factor H (fH) comprises 20 short consensus repeats (SCRs); fH binds C3b in the convertase, displacing Bb to inactivate the convertase. fH bound to C3b is also a cofactor for cleavage of C3b by factor I (fI) to yield the inactive product iC3b. Complement polymorphisms affect AP activation/regulation in different ways (red arrows). The fBR32Q modulates fB affinity for C3b in convertase formation; fBR32 binds better so makes more pro-convertase, more convertase and more AP activation (stronger binding illustrated by solid red arrow). C3R102G affects affinity of C3b for fH; C3b102G binds fH less strongly (weaker binding illustrated by broken red arrow), leading to less efficient C3b inactivation by fI, and thus drives more AP activation. fHV62I (in SCR1, green) also affects C3b-fH binding; fH62I binds C3b more strongly (unbroken arrow) so better regulates the convertase, facilitates C3b cleavage and inhibits AP activation. These three AP polymorphisms, influencing AP activity in different ways, collaborate to set AP activating capacity. Other disease-associated AP polymorphisms also affect activity; for example, the AMD-associated fHY402H polymorphism (in SCR7, blue) probably alters capacity of fH to bind surfaces in the eye, influencing local convertase regulation.
Combined allele frequency of common polymorphic variants in C3R102G (rs2230199; single allele frequency R/G: 0.8/0.2), fBR32Q (rs641153; R/Q: 0.765/0.11), and fHV62I (rs800292; V/I: 0.79/0.21) and their expected prevalence in the Spanish population .
| Allele Combination | % Frequency | Prevalence in Caucasians |
|---|---|---|
| C3102RR, fB32RR, fH62VV | 23.4 | 4 (i.e., 1 in 4) |
| C3102RR, fB32RR, fH62VI | 12.4 | 8 |
| C3102GR, fB32RR, fH62VV | 11.7 | 9 |
| C3102RR, fB32RQ, fH62VV | 6.7 | 15 |
| C3102GR, fB32RR, fH62VI | 6.2 | 16 |
| C3102RR, fB32RQ, fH62VI | 3.6 | 28 |
| C3102GR, fB32RQ, fH62VV | 3.4 | 30 |
| C3102GG, fB32RQ, fH62VV | 2.1 | 48 |
| C3102GR, fB32RQ, fH62VI | 1.8 | 56 |
| C3102RR, fB32RR, fH62II | 1.7 | 61 |
| C3102GG, fB32RR, fH62VV | 1.5 | 68 |
| C3102GR, fB32RR, fH62II | 0.83 | 121 |
| C3102GG, fB32RR, fH62VI | 0.78 | 129 |
| C3102RR, fB32QQ, fH62VV | 0.48 | 207 |
| C3102RR, fB32RQ, fH62II | 0.48 | 211 |
| C3102RR, fB32QQ, fH62VI | 0.257 | 389 |
| C3102GR, fB32QQ, fH62VV | 0.24 | 414 |
| C3102GR, fB32RQ, fH62II | 0.24 | 421 |
| C3102GG, fB32RQ, fH62VI | 0.22 | 448 |
| C3102GR, fB32QQ, fH62VI | 0.13 | 778 |
| C3102GG, fB32RR, fH62II | 0.10 | 969 |
| C3102RR, fB32QQ, fH62II | 0.034 | 2928 |
| C3102GG, fB32QQ, fH62VV | 0.030 | 3311 |
| C3102GG, fB32RQ, fH62II | 0.030 | 3368 |
| C3102GR,fB32QQ, fH62II | 0.017 | 5856 |
| C3102GG, fB32QQ, fH62VI | 0.016 | 6227 |
| C3102GG, fB32QQ, fH62II | 0.002 | 46851 |
